What are hormones
The word hormone comes from the Greek, is a general term for hormones, and later, scholars defined hormones as trace chemical substances produced by endocrine organs, then released into the blood circulation, and transferred to the target organ or tissue to play a certain effect.
Each endocrine gland produces one or more hormones, whose chemical composition is broadly divided into five groups: proteins, peptides, glycoproteins, steroids, and amino acids. Different kinds of hormones have different components, different functions, hormones both men and women, so there are male hormones and female hormones.
